TURN-208: Gatevale turnstile counters at the Merrow Field pilot double-count when a rotation reverses mid-cycle. Attendance totals drift roughly 2% high per event. The debounce window fix is implemented, reviewed by Ilsa, and soak-tested across two simulated match days without drift. Ready for your cut; the candidate build is identified below.

trace token, tagag-tafog: htk6_5ed18c

## Onboarding: Spoolhaven Maintenance Basics

Spoolhaven is the printer-spooler microservice that sits between the Ledgewell apps and the office print fleet. It accepts jobs over the internal queue, normalizes them to our house PDF profile, and tracks job state in its own small datastore. Restarts are safe; jobs are idempotent. The one thing you must know on day one: if the datastore comes up sealed after an unclean shutdown, it must be manually unsealed. The unseal recovery passphrase is provided below.

recovery phrase for fawif-tajeg: norael-aldmir-casir-brivan-ulaion

// FX_ROUNDING_SCALE — decimal places kept during Pennywhistle currency
// conversion. Never round intermediate values; round once at display.
// Lowering this reintroduces the half-cent drift bug from the Q3 ledger
// audit. If totals mismatch by <0.01, check this first. Fixed as of the
// build noted below.

trace token, kahog-tajeg: htk6_97d963

Subject: Feed validator update for weekly sync

Team — the Murmuret podcast feed validator now checks enclosure MIME types and rejects feeds with duplicate episode GUIDs, which were the top two causes of ingestion failures last quarter. Validation runs in about 400 ms per feed, so no pipeline timing changes are needed. The change is behind a flag until Thursday. Reference the build with the token below.

trace token, kawip-fafog: htk14_26e64c4d35154e